Output e8c9654e1f5696c21d65d9b90d76283733f7e1a1f6a47a6bec387bd7cf52874d:8

value
564000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8959325943c0b92344b60949400d81f2bb965a38 OP_EQUAL
address
3EDFMKQQeqdmHJgDfHCsvUZkD2aFYanq7X
transaction
e8c9654e1f5696c21d65d9b90d76283733f7e1a1f6a47a6bec387bd7cf52874d